Key Postcode Insights
M16 8QW is a residential postcode situated on Athol Road, Manchester, M16 with 48 addresses.
It ranks as the 722nd largest and 242nd most expensive of the 789 postcodes in the M16 area. The most common property type is a period flat built between 1800 and 1911.
The postcode contains a total of 48 properties: 20 houses and 28 flats.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ale in M16 8QW sold for £155,000 on 30th April 2026. Since then prices are up an average of 1.0%.
The current average value in the postcode is £260,217.
The M16 8QW Sales Market has increased by 41.9% over the last 10 years.
